build: 5s delay + note when binary images are used

We deprecate binary images during Yoga cycle and drop in Z one.

Reminding users on each run to make sure they notice.

Change-Id: I62148b95e226711cbc70ab2a411774114f9dd7b1
This commit is contained in:
Marcin Juszkiewicz 2021-11-18 13:58:27 +01:00
parent dc683fa1cc
commit 3239812c3d
1 changed files with 6 additions and 0 deletions

View File

@ -681,6 +681,12 @@ class KollaWorker(object):
"due to lack of packages for other architectures.")
sys.exit(1)
if self.install_type == 'binary':
LOG.info("Building binary images is now deprecated. Consider "
"switching to source ones.")
LOG.info("Build will continue in 5 seconds.")
time.sleep(5)
self.image_prefix = self.base + '-' + self.install_type + '-'
if self.conf.infra_rename:
self.infra_image_prefix = self.base + '-infra-'